Arquitecturas en la nube que cuidan el presupuesto y vuelan rápido

Hoy nos adentramos en diseñar arquitecturas de nube rentables sin comprometer el rendimiento, combinando decisiones técnicas inteligentes con disciplina financiera diaria. Exploraremos principios, patrones, métricas y anécdotas que demuestran cómo mantener latencias bajas, alta disponibilidad y seguridad, mientras reducimos costos de cómputo, almacenamiento y red. Te invitamos a aplicar, medir y compartir lo aprendido para crecer con confianza y previsibilidad.

Principios que evitan derroches y aceleran resultados

Construir bien desde el inicio significa adoptar elasticidad por defecto, diseñar para picos reales y entender el costo marginal de cada decisión. La clave está en medir antes de escalar, separar cargas críticas de procesos elásticos y anticipar cuellos de botella. Estos fundamentos reducen sorpresas, maximizan el valor por cada unidad de cómputo y convierten la arquitectura en un motor de negocio sostenible, predecible y ágil.

Patrones y servicios que suman velocidad sin inflar la factura

Elegir el patrón adecuado para cada carga marca la diferencia entre pagar por picos raros y pagar exactamente por lo que usas. Serverless para eventos impredecibles, contenedores livianos para servicios estables, y cómputo oportunista para trabajos tolerantes a interrupciones. Combinados con buenas prácticas de empaquetado, colas resilientes y control de concurrencia, habilitan tiempos de respuesta consistentes y una contabilidad feliz.

Serverless con cabeza fría

Aprovecha facturación granular y escalado automático sin ignorar arranques en frío, límites de ejecución y patrones de idempotencia. Precalienta rutas críticas, utiliza provisión mínima donde sea imprescindible y centraliza configuraciones compartidas para reducir duplicidades. Orquesta funciones con colas y eventos bien diseñados, evitando explosiones de concurrencia. Gestionado con observabilidad fina, este enfoque brilla en picos irregulares y reduce significativamente el costo total.

Contenedores ligeros y escalado inteligente

Imágenes pequeñas, procesos únicos y límites de recursos realistas mejoran densidad y previsibilidad. Combina autoescalado por latencia y consumo con recomendaciones de tamaño, y usa nodos oportunistas donde la carga lo permita. Implementa tolerancias y presupuestos de interrupción para actualizaciones seguras. Con pipelines que detectan regresiones de desempeño, mantendrás despliegues rápidos, consumo controlado y una plataforma lista para crecer sin facturas sorpresivas.

Datos bien ubicados: latencia corta, almacenamiento barato

La proximidad de datos al usuario y la elección correcta de clases de almacenamiento impactan costos y experiencia. Diseña capas: cachés cercanas, almacenamiento transaccional ajustado, objetos en niveles por temperatura y archivado con políticas de ciclo de vida. Minimiza salidas de red duplicadas, aprovecha compresión y formatos columnares donde convenga. Cada byte bien colocado acelera respuestas, reduce facturas y simplifica la operativa diaria.

Observabilidad enfocada en valor y no en volumen

La telemetría debe responder preguntas del negocio, no llenar discos. Establece SLOs claros, diseña paneles accionables y usa muestreo inteligente para trazas y registros. Prioriza métricas que predicen dolor del usuario y riesgos de costo. Con retención por niveles y agregaciones en origen, mantienes visibilidad profunda sin derroches. La consecuencia natural es una operación más calmada, predecible y económicamente saludable.

Resiliencia práctica que protege al cliente y al balance contable

Diseñar para fallas no significa duplicarlo todo. Entiende dónde la redundancia paga y dónde basta con recuperación rápida. Usa tolerancia a errores, reintentos inteligentes y timeouts estrictos para aislar problemas sin desperdiciar recursos. Prioriza multizona para alta disponibilidad y evalúa multirregión solo cuando el negocio lo exige. Así resguardas la experiencia del usuario y evitas gastos permanentes desalineados con el valor real.

Multi-zona sin exagerar

Distribuir instancias entre zonas diferentes reduce riesgos locales, pero cada salto añade costos de red y complejidad de quorum. Elige réplicas con consciencia de escritura y lectura, valida degradaciones aceptables y prueba conmutaciones periódicas. Documenta dependencias transzonas y limita tráfico chattiness. Con equilibrio entre robustez y frugalidad, obtendrás continuidad operativa real sin pagar por redundancias que rara vez ofrecen beneficios tangibles.

Pruebas de caos con límites claros

Introduce fallas controladas para verificar hipótesis de resiliencia, con ventanas definidas, métricas protectoras y planes de reversión. Practica game days donde equipos técnicos y de negocio midan impacto real y tiempos de recuperación. Ajusta umbrales y elimina dependencias frágiles descubiertas. Esta disciplina fortalece confianza, documenta procedimientos y prioriza inversiones que realmente aumentan disponibilidad, evitando compras impulsivas de complejidad y capacidad innecesarias.

Colas, reintentos y timeouts con propósito

Establece límites de tiempo estrictos para evitar llamadas colgantes, implementa retrocesos con jitter y asegura idempotencia en operaciones repetidas. Encapsula integraciones frágiles detrás de colas con políticas de retraso y circuit breakers. Monitorea tasas de reintento y costos asociados. Este diseño evita tormentas de fallas, estabiliza el gasto en momentos críticos y protege la percepción del usuario cuando partes externas se comportan de forma impredecible.

FinOps cotidiano: cultura, etiquetas y decisiones con números

El control de costos no es una auditoría esporádica, sino un hábito compartido. Define presupuestos por producto, estandariza etiquetas para visibilidad y vincula decisiones técnicas con métricas financieras entendibles. Crea revisiones quincenales con responsables claros y experimentos medibles. Negocia compromisos de uso solo tras validar estabilidad. Esta práctica convierte cada sprint en una oportunidad de ahorrar, sin fricciones ni sorpresas para clientes internos o externos.
Kentozavopirapentolentovaro
Privacy Overview

This website uses cookies so that we can provide you with the best user experience possible. Cookie information is stored in your browser and performs functions such as recognising you when you return to our website and helping our team to understand which sections of the website you find most interesting and useful.